Id Represents the Internet Key Exchange (IKE) ID payload.
IdType Defines the IKE ID payload type. This value can include a fully qualified domain name
or an Internet Protocol version 4 (IPv4) address.
InitiatorInstance Defines the name of the iSCSI initiator used to perform the login operation.
The iSCSI initiator service chooses an iSCSI initiator when you don??™t provide this value.

InitiatorName Specifies the name of the iSCSI initiator normally used to login to the target
(the tunnel mode outer address when used for IPSec). You must configure the iSCSI initiator for
this purpose. When working with IPSec, providing a value of asterisk (*) configures all iSCSI initiators
to use the caller??™s address.
InitiatorPort Specifies the physical port number of the iSCSI initiator for the specified
tunnel mode outer address. When working with IPSec, providing a value of asterisk (*) configures
all ports to use the caller??™s address.
iSNSServerAddress Represents a particular iSNS server.
